Overall, I had a semi-positive experience getting my new tires installed here. The staff was professional and straightforward, and the tire install itself was done correctly and with the right tires that I ordered beforehand. They explained my options clearly and answered all my questions. The pricing for the tires felt fair, and the quality of work was solid. That said, the process was slower than expected. I waited 4 hours for a simple tire install and front-end alignment. Be prepared to wait longer for your vehicle, even with an appointment. My appointment started at 7:30AM and ended at 11:30AM. It wasn't a deal-breaker, but it's something you as a customer should plan around.
They also pushed a front-end alignment. I get why it's recommended, but it definitely felt like an upsell, since it was already included in my price sheet printout, adding an extra $150.00 to my expected price. I didn't appreciate the inclusion on the printout. How about showing me what I ordered and then recommending the front-end alignment.
So after I drove away I noticed that my steering wheel was off-center and the car was now pulling to the right. This was so frustrating and I had to go back again. This time I waited over 2 hours.
All in all, good work and professional service. Just allow extra time and expect the alignment recommendation.
